Childline

If you’re under 19 you can confidentially call, chat online or email about any problem big or small.

Sign up for a free Childline locker (real name or email address not needed) to use their free 1-2-1 counsellor chat and email support service. 

Opening times: 24/7

call: 0800 11 11

Shout


Shout provides free, 24/7 text support for young people across the UK experiencing a mental health crisis.

All texts are answered by trained volunteers, with support from experienced clinical supervisors.

Texts are free from most UK networks.

Opening times: 24/7

Text SHOUT to 85258.

No Panic UK

No Panic offers advice, support, recovery programs and help for people living with phobias, OCD and any other anxiety-based disorders.

No Panic Youth Helpline (open until 10pm)

0330 606 1174

24h Crisis Line: 01952 680835
